Track and Field

Lancer boys finish first, girls finish fourth at St. John’s Invite

DELPHOS – Lincolnview enjoyed a strong showing at Saturday’s Delphos St. John’s Invitational, with the boys scoring 143 points to bring home the championship trophy, while the girls finished with 94 points, to finish fourth out of eight teams.

“It was a great meet for both teams,” head coach Matt Langdon said. “We had a tough week of practice, and it was good to see the kids come out and compete at such a high level. They fought hard the entire meet and showed great focus and preparation.”

Ryan Rager claimed first place finishes in the 400 meter run (52.77 seconds) and the long jump (19-08.75), while Evan Cox placed first in the high jump (5-8.00).

The 4×800 meter relay team of Karter Tow, Alek Bowersock, Jacob Keysor and Austin Elick took first place (8:58.88 seconds), as did the 4×400 meter relay team of Logan Williams, Brad Korte, Elick and Rager (3:44.84 seconds).

Second place finishes were claimed by Tow (1600 and 3200 meter runs), Elick (800 meter run) and Korte (high jump).

On the girls side, Olivia Gorman placed first in the long jump (14-00.00) along with the 4×100 meter relay team of Gorman, Raegan Boley, Brooke Thatcher and Makenna Klausing (55.93 seconds).

Klausing also finished second in the long jump.

Softball

Lincolnview, Kalida split doubleheader

The Lady Lancers won game one 13-7, but the Lady Wildcats won game two 5-4 during Saturday’s doubleheader at Lincolnview High School.

Lana Carey finished the afternoon with six hits, Carly Wendel had four, and Lakin Brant, Alana Looser and Zoe Miller each had three.

Lincolnview (3-6) will host Paulding today.

Tennis

Cougars compete at Elida Invite

ELIDA — Gahanna Lincoln won Saturday’s four-team Elida Invitational with 16 points, while Van Wert and Wapakoneta tied for second with seven points apiece. The host Bulldogs finished fourth, with six points.

Van Wert’s Ryan Keber claimed second place honors, as did the doubles duo of Michael Etter and Gabe Rollins.

The Cougars will return to Elida tomorrow, for regular season Western Buckeye League action against the Bulldogs.
